The representative Summoner from Final Fantasy IV, Rydia is one of the most prominent Summoners in the series's history. She has made more than a dozen appearances in anthologies, compilations, crossovers, and non-canon works.

Rydia appears as a non-elemental summon. She is a limited edition cameo summon as part of the "Summoner Rydia" event.

Three versions of Rydia's Phantom Stone are available to players, Rydia, Rydia RE, and Rydia OR. All Rydia Phantom Stones share the special attack, "Mist Dragon", which distributes the user's HP to the entire party. Summoning any of the Rydia summons costs 2 points from the Consumption Gauge.

Each Phantom Stone of Rydia is based of a specific design of Rydia from throughout the Final Fantasy IV series of games. The Rydia Phantom Stone artwork is based on her character design from the 3D remake, the Rydia RE Phantom Stones use her child and adult 3D models from the 3D version of the game, and the Rydia OR stone uses her sprites from the cellphone port of Final Fantasy IV.

Dissidia Final Fantasy

Template:Sideicon Rydia makes a cameo in her child form as a tutor for the in-game manuals. She exchanges information on Summoning and Summonstones with Edward.

Dissidia 012 Final Fantasy

Template:Sideicon Rydia appears as a tutor for the in-game manuals. As she did in Dissidia Final Fantasy, she explains Summoning and Summonstones, this time using her adult portrait and sharing her role with Edge.

Theatrhythm Final Fantasy

Template:Sideicon

Rydia.

A young girl from the summoner's village Mist. Emotionally scarred by the burning of her village, a ruthless massacre ordered by the king of Baron, she initially hates Cecil for robbing her of her home and her mother. But his gentle ways break through her shell and despite the complicated feelings he inspires in her, she will travel with the Dark Knight until she is swallowed by the summoned Leviathan.

Online description

Rydia appears as an unlockable character, obtained by collecting Green Crystal Shards. Her appearance is her child form based on her Yoshitaka Amano art.

Rydia's maintains her role as a powerful summoner with strong black magic. Additionally, she has several support abilities to recover the party's health, increase magic and also her own Agility. Overall, she's a solid magic character with great support abilities.

Theatrhythm Final Fantasy Curtain Call

Template:Sideicon

The last summoner of Mist, the one place on Earth closest to the Eidolons. Despite her sorrowful past, she lives on in courage and fights alongside Cecil, the dark knight who brought about her mother's death...

CollectaCard

Rydia returns as an unlockable character, and is now obtained by collecting Peach Crystal Shards. Despite still appearing as a child, Rydia's size has not been adjusted, and she stands at the same level as almost all other characters, unlike Shantotto.

Rydia remains a strong mage with a plethora of spells at her disposal, and although she loses several support skills, she also gains more magic to utilise and the ability to boost her Luck, making her useful for obtaining treasures on both field and battle.

Final Fantasy Record Keeper

Template:Sideicon

FFRK Child Rydia Sprite

Rydia joins the player party as a child. A standard character, Rydia is recruited as the First Time Reward for completing the Record of Fabul in the Realm of Final Fantasy IV on the Classic difficulty track. She has also appeared in The Burning Blade and Twin Stars of Mysidia, where in both events she is also easier to acquire. She can grow into her adult self with the Chosen of Feymarch Wardrobe Record, obtained during A Summoner Grown.

Final Fantasy Brave Exvius

Template:Sideicon Rydia appears as a vision obtainable through summoning. Her job is Summoner. Her trust mastery reward is Blizzaga. She possesses the special abilities Binding EVO MAG +10% and EVO MAG +20%. She possesses the magics Blizzard, Thunder, Bio, Blizzara, Thundara, Drain, Biora, Osmose, Bioga, Thundaga and Meteor. Her limit bursts are Asura's Wish and Leviathan Guard.

No. 099: A young girl from a distant world with two moons. Born to a family of summoners in Mist, she lost her mother when the kingdom of Baron, fearing the power of the Eidolons, razed her home. Initially despising Cecil for his role in the attack, she gradually opens up to her new companion upon witnessing his kindness. Carrying the scars from the loss of her village, she matures as a summoner under the gentle care of Cecil and Rosa.
No. 100: A young summoner girl who hails from a distant world where two moons rise in the sky. Pure and true of heart, she suffers a tragedy when her home, the village of Mist, is burned to the ground by order of the king of Baron, who feared the power of the Eidolons. She joins Cecil and his companions on their journey, but is thought to be lost when swallowed by the great Leviathan. Later she returns from the Feymarch, home of the Eidolons, as a woman grown, lending her prodigious powers to her former companions as they face their greatest challenge.
No. 300: A young girl who appears in the tales of a blue planet watched over by two moons. Rydia is a summoner, and a survivor of the village of Mist. While journeying with Cecil and his companions, she was swallowed by the great Leviathan, only to later return from the Feymarch as a grown woman. Even as a full-fledged adult, Rydia retained her innocence and strength of spirit; her pure heart enabling her to befriend many Eidolons. She continued using their incredible power to help Cecil and his comrades on their quest, till the very end.

World of Final Fantasy

Template:Sideicon

WoFF Rydia
Who's Who
Rydia
CV: Caroline Macey / Noriko Shitaya
Age in Grymoire: 16
Familiar: Mist Dragon
Notes: Summoner / Researching the Crimson Prophecy / Looks up to Yuna as a role model
Bad Memories
Rydia has a paralyzing fear of fire, brought on by the trauma she experienced when a calamity befell her home village of Mist. She lost her family that day, and even now sees the inferno that consumed them in every spark or flicker of flame. And try as she might, she has yet to overcome her phobia.
Growing Up
The original Rydia from Final Fantasy IV underwent a rather unique aging process during her time in the Feymarch, but here in Grymoire she has grown up at the same pace as any other girl. As a result, she's a little bit more down-to-earth than you might remember.
Rydia's mother was also a summoner, which makes the two of them a rarity in Grymoire, where Lilikin do not generally pass on such powers to their children.
Fighting Fire
Since meeting Reynn and Lann, Rydia has made great progress in overcoming her fear of flames. She's still got a ways to go, but the healing has already begun.

Lord of Vermilion

RydiaLoV2Gameplay

Rydia casting Hastega in Lord of Vermilion II.

Rydia appears as a card and summonable creature in Lord of Vermilion II, along with other characters from Final Fantasy IV as part of a special cross promotion. Her card is Super Rare, and has an Attack and Defense of 35. Rydia's special ability is Hastega. An update of her card reappears in Lord of Vermilion Re:2, the second version of the game. In addition to this, a limited edition of Rydia as a child is also available.

Heavenstrike Rivals

Rydia appears as a unit in a collaboration event.[1] Rydia of Mist and Summoner Rydia are units and their ability is Summon Forth. Rydia of Mist can be promoted to Summoner Rydia.
